5 Deinstallation
Preconditions:
• Vacuum system vented
• Vacuum system cooled to <50 °C
5.1 Power Connection
Put the gauge out of operation.
Unfasten the lock screws and disconnect the sensor cable.
5.2 Vacuum connection
DANGER
DANGER: hot surface
Touching the hot surface (>50 °C) can cause
burns.
Put the product out of operation and allow it to cool
down.
WARNING
WARNING: fragile components
The ceramic sensor may be damaged by impacts.
Do not drop the product and prevent shocks and
impacts.
